Diaries, 1864-1917, with a few gaps, in 40 volumes. They deal with academic and family affairs, including accounts of his reading, the progress of his books, meetings of societies and committees, conversations and correspondence.

Cambridge UL, Add. MSS. 7827-7867.

About 250 letters to Keynes, 1872-1918, on family and univer­sity matters, with a few from economists.

Cambridge UL, Add. MS. 7562.

About 400 letters to him, 1891-1942 (but mainly pre-1900). Marshall Library, Cambridge.

Notebooks, four with material probably collected for a new edi­tion of his Formal Logic, post-1884, and six containing notes on his reading, mainly on economics, c. 1875. Pembroke College, Cambridge.

Seven volumes of notes, mainly from Henry Sidgwick's lectures on philosophy and ethics, 1874-1876. KC, Cambridge.

Two volumes of collected examination questions on logic, mainly from the 1870s and 1880s.

Cambridge UL, Add. MSS. 7322-7323.

Correspondents

HERBERT SOMERTON FOXWELL, five letters, 1902-1916. Marshall Library, Cambridge.

HERBERT SOMERTON FOXWELL, 101 letters to, 1877-1931, in RDFC; 34 letters, 1877-1917 in .J. N. Keynes correspondence, Marshall Library, Cambridge; five letters, 1900,

Foxwell papers, Baker Library, Harvard University.

CHRISTINE LADD FRANKLIN, three letters, 1903-1905.

Franklin papers, Columbia UL, New York.

FRANCIS JOHN HENRY JENKINSON, ten letters, 1893-1919. Cambridge UL, Add. MS. 6463.

MACMILLAN, many letters, 1883-1941. BL Add. MS. 55207.

ALFRED MARSHALL, four letters, 1884-1902. Marshall papers, Marshall Library, Cambridge.

SIR ROBERT HARRY INGLIS PALGRAVE, three letters, 1886-1887.
